Abstract
A cooling module includes a shroud (38) having an integral cover (42). The cover receives a bearing structure (40). A fan (36) is provided for moving air. A rotor and stator assembly (30) has an opened end and includes a stator (29) having permanent magnets. A rotor (31) includes a lamination stack (16), windings (21), a commutator (20); and a shaft (18). The rotor is associated with the stator so as to rotate with respect thereto. One end (34) of the shaft is coupled with the fan and another end (39) of the shaft is received by the bearing structure. A brush and connector unit (52) is associated with the cover of the shroud and includes brushes (58) associated with the commutator, and an electrical connector (62). The cover covers the opened end of the rotor and stator assembly and covers at least a portion of a brush and connector unit.
